Prince Olav of Norway pictured with his bride Princess Martha of Sweden on the occasion of their marriage in March 1929. The Duke of York (later king George VI) was best man to Prince Olaf, his cousin. The bride, according to the caption, was a vision of regal radiance in her wedding dress with its exquisite veil of silver lace. Date: 1929
Bridemaides: Miss Irmelin Nansen, miss Elisabeth Broch, miss Ragnhild Fearnley, miss Harriet Wedel-Jarlsberg, princess Ingrid of Sweden, miss Ekelund, miss Elsa Steuch, miss Carleson
